Before Quindell (LON:QPP) can be listed, their sponsor  Canaccord Genuity Inc (LON:CF.)  must get QPP’s prospectus approved by the UKLA. Although the prospectus is a legal document, it is also a marketing tool to help to sell shares to potential investors. Hence it needs to be perfect for the upcoming Teach-In on the 17th Jun, stand up to scrutiny at the AGM, and satisfy all current investors.

The drafting of a prospectus takes several weeks and will involve all of QPP's advisers. A number of drafting sessions will have taken place already on various sections of the document. Although RT confirmed submission on 22nd April (or around that date) this was likely one of the first drafts - if not the first!

From a marketing perspective, the prospectus outlines QPP's strengths, strategy and market opportunity - plus the risks of course.

QPP's sponsor is responsible for submitting drafts of the prospectus to the UKLA. The UKLA is allowed 10 business days after the first submission to respond to the sponsor with a comment sheet. QPP and its advisers will then revise the prospectus so that the sponsor can submit an updated draft with the UKLA for a further review. For the second and subsequent drafts, the UKLA responds via its comment sheet within five business days.

As every transaction is unique, it is impossible to predict exactly how long this entire process will take. As I said in my tweet - due to QPP's recent acquisitions it is likely the process will take longer due to the due diligence that is required.

However, as a general rule, the timeframe is approximately six to eight weeks from initial submission of the prospectus to the UKLA (approximately three to four submissions) to preliminary approval ahead of launching the transaction.
